As a Digital IC Design Lead Engineer at Innova IRV Microelectronics, you will join our engineering team based in Málaga, working together to shape next-generation chip solutions. You will lead the architecture, RTL design, integration and implementation of digital IPs and subsystems for next-generation RISC-V SoC platforms. The role combines hands-on technical expertise with Digital IC Design Engineers leadership, ensuring designs meet functional, performance, power, area, quality and schedule objectives.
